The Tánaiste insists Covid-19 is 'in retreat' across Ireland and the country is on the right track.
575 new cases were confirmed here yesterday, along with 45 additional deaths.
218 of the cases are in Dublin, while the second highest number- 38 new cases - are in Galway.
Elsewhere across the West, there are 15 new cases in Mayo, 10 in Roscommon, 7 in Sligo and less than 5 in Leitrim.
The 14 day incidence rate of the disease is now 240 per 100,000 of the population.
13 counties - including Galway and Mayo - have rates above the national average.
Galway's 14-day rate is now 330 and Mayo's is 255 per 100,000 people.
The number of Covid patients in public hospitals has fallen to 642 - the lowest in over seven weeks - while 151 of these patients are in ICU.
